I really expected to see a defensive clinic put on in the AFC championship game, and I did indeed see that... expect I thought Baltimore would be the ones teaching the lesson, not getting taught. The Chiefs were magnificent in a January game, not at all unusual over the last six seasons. Travis Kelce in particular had an outstanding game; not only does he have the most receptions in playoff history (passing the legendary Jerry Rice) and not only is he a shoo-in for the Hall of Fame when the time comes, he's spending many of his nights with Taylor Swift!

Heh-heh. No, I'm not jealous. Not much, anyway.

I should have known better that to pick against Patrick Mahomes in a playoff game. This was his 17th postseason game; he has won 14 of them. That includes a 2-1 record in the Super Bowl; he'll be attending his fourth in just six seasons as a starter. He has a way to go to catch the GOAT, Tom Brady, but there is nobody better at what he does on the planet. I was wrong on this pick (6-5 in the playoffs for me) but I do not mind a bit.
